The article argues that the rise of AI agents is reviving CPU relevance, as agentic workloads require strong general-purpose compute alongside GPUs for orchestration, memory handling, and tool calls. This reframes the narrative from GPU-only dominance and could benefit incumbent CPU vendors and adjacent memory/packaging suppliers as datacenter architectures rebalance.

After racing to develop custom AI accelerators, US hyperscalers including Amazon, Google, Microsoft and Meta are now extending in-house silicon efforts into general-purpose CPUs to reduce reliance on Intel and AMD. The shift signals deeper vertical integration in data center silicon and further pressure on incumbent x86 CPU vendors, while expanding the addressable market for Arm-based designs and TSMC's advanced-node foundry capacity.
